Transaction 157993c80122383ce0f34ed2c9c34ffde799b1ee427b7d977761072cde66e903

1 Input
2 Outputs
  • 157993c80122383ce0f34ed2c9c34ffde799b1ee427b7d977761072cde66e903:0
  • value  31395085
    address  3PYAaQTcp8sMZRoTFsdwF6LECKCiPhjtoA
  • 157993c80122383ce0f34ed2c9c34ffde799b1ee427b7d977761072cde66e903:1
  • value  145291671
    address  38paaYB3Poqxyf7tsbZd8hvJYjHUR4kN4e